Micah, God gave us analog ear drums, so that's the way sound comes out of the speakers, but the preceding connections and processing can be digital at least as well. As Ken and Doc Horse pointed out, things have to be calibrated equally for the result to sound the same. In particular the volume has to be exactly the same(within .1dB)so that things aren't different mostly because of loudness(as appears to be the case in your example). This is also the main factor in mysterious claims for amplifiers about things that they don't control(e.g., "sound-stage").
